The Executive Development Programme in Collaborative Education Collaboration is a certificate course designed to empower education professionals with the skills needed to thrive in today's collaborative learning environments. This programme emphasizes the importance of partnerships in education, fostering a deep understanding of how to work effectively with various stakeholders to drive positive outcomes.

In an era where education is increasingly interdisciplinary and interconnected, this course is in high demand. It equips learners with essential skills for career advancement, such as communication, problem-solving, and leadership. By completing this programme, education professionals demonstrate a commitment to staying at the forefront of their field and a dedication to providing the best possible learning experiences for their students. Throughout the course, learners will engage in real-world case studies, interactive discussions, and practical exercises that build their capacity to collaborate and lead. They will leave the programme with a renewed sense of purpose, a robust professional network, and the skills needed to drive meaningful change in their organizations and beyond.
